Classifi cation
An IEEE 802.3af PD has the option of presenting a
classifi cation signature to the PSE to indicate how much
power it will draw when operating. This signature consists
of a specifi c constant-current draw when the PSE port
voltage is between 15.5V and 20.5V, with the current level
indicating the power class to which the PD belongs. Per
the IEEE 802.3af specifi cation, there are fi ve classes and
three power levels for a PD as shown in Table 1. Note that
class 4 is presently reserved by the IEEE for future use.
Figure 4 shows an example PD load line, starting with the
shallow slope of the 25k signature resistor below 10V, then
drawing the classifi cation current (in this case, class 3)
between 15.5V and 20.5V. Also shown is the load line for
the LTC4263. It maintains a low impedance until reaching
current limit at 60mA (typ).
The LTC4263 will classify a port immediately after a
successful detection. It measures the PD classifi cation
signature current by applying 18V (typ) to the port and
measuring the resulting current. The LTC4263 identifi es
the three IEEE power levels and stores the detected class
internally for use by the power management circuitry. In
addition, the LTC4263 allows selectable enforcement of
IEEE classifi cation power levels. With the ENFCLS pin
high, the LTC4263 reduces the I
CUT
current threshold if it
detects class 1 or class 2, thereby insuring that PDs which
violate their advertised class are shut down.
